What is an Entry Level Embedded Software Engineer job?

An Entry Level Embedded Software Engineer designs, develops, and tests software that runs on embedded systems, such as microcontrollers and IoT devices. They work with low-level programming languages like C and C++, interact with hardware, and optimize system performance. Responsibilities often include writing firmware, debugging code, and collaborating with hardware engineers. This role is ideal for candidates with a background in computer science, electrical engineering, or a related field and a strong understanding of embedded systems concepts.

What are the key skills and qualifications needed to thrive in the Entry Level Embedded Software Engineer position, and why are they important?

To succeed as an Entry Level Embedded Software Engineer, strong programming skills in C/C++, understanding of microcontrollers, and a relevant engineering degree are fundamental. Familiarity with embedded development environments, version control systems such as Git, and basic debugging tools is highly valued, though certifications like embedded systems courses can be advantageous. Effective communication, problem-solving abilities, and a willingness to learn help candidates integrate smoothly into multidisciplinary teams. These qualifications are essential because they ensure you can develop, test, and troubleshoot reliable embedded software within collaborative engineering environments.

What You'll Do

  • Contribute to technical innovation and product improvements aligned with customer needs and mission goals.

  • Firmware & Software development for microcontrollers and FPGAs.

  • Circuit board level design of high reliability, high voltage (1kV or greater) DC/DC power systems

  • Circuit board level design of simultaneously sampled remote analog data acquisition equipment

  • Design of long-distance fiber optic telemetry systems

  • Support system architecture, subsystem trade studies, and design decisions across hardware, firmware, software, mechanical, manufacturing, and test disciplines.

  • Plan, execute, and document verification and validation activities, including engineering tests, qualification tests, acceptance tests, troubleshooting, and anomaly resolution.

  • Create and maintain engineering documentation including specifications, interface control documents, schematics, test procedures, test reports, design analyses, build documentation, and lifecycle support artifacts.

  • Support design reviews, production readiness reviews, failure investigations, corrective actions, and technical risk reduction activities.

  • Work with manufacturing, quality, supply chain, and program teams to transition designs from prototype through production and field support.

  • Contribute to configuration management, change control, design release, and product baseline maintenance for hardware, firmware, and documentation.
